What was supposed to be a fun train journey turned into a stressful experience for a group of friends According to the person who shared the incident they had booked and paid for three seats in Train No 11109 Coach D1 During the journey, an elderly man reportedly approached them and insisted that one of them move aside so he could sit The group politely refused explaining that they had paid for the entire seating arrangement they were using However instead of accepting their response the man allegedly became aggressive The person claims he started pressuring them issued threats and even said Meet me at Lucknow station I'll show you then He also reportedly claimed to be a member of the railway staff The passengers said the confrontation left them shocked and upset, especially since they were simply traveling to enjoy their day. What should have been an exciting trip was overshadowed by an unpleasant argument If such situations occur during a train journey, passengers are generally advised to remain calm, avoid escalating the confrontation, verify the other person's identity if they claim to be railway staff, and immediately report the matter to the Train Ticket Examiner (TTE), coach attendant, or the Railway Protection Force (RPF). If anyone feels threatened, they can also use the Rail Madad platform or contact the Railway Security Helpline for assistance. The incident has sparked discussion online, with many people saying that disagreements over seats should be handled respectfully and that no passenger should be threatened during a journey.
